Dr. No ★★★ 1962 (PG)
The world is introduced to British secret agent 007, James Bond, when it is discovered that mad scientist Dr. No (Wiseman) is sabotaging rocket launchings from his hideout in Jamaica. The first 007 film is far less glitzy than any of its successors but boasts the sexiest “Bond girl” of them all in Andress as Honey Ryder who walks out of the surf in a white bikini, and promptly made stars of her and Connery. 111m/C VHS, DVD . GB Sean Connery, Ursula Andress, Joseph Wiseman, Jack Lord, Zena Marshall, Eunice Gayson, Margaret LeWars, John Kitzmiller, Lois Maxwell, Bernard Lee, Anthony Dawson; D: Terence Young; W: Johanna Harwood, Richard Maibaum, Berkely Mather; C: Ted Moore; M: John Barry.
